        Correct quality, insufficient basic filtration

        Good quality and finish.
        The instructions for use are ridiculous, but the ventilation is satisfactory with the two fans supplied. However the filtration is absent, all the vents are present but let the dust through.
        With its 4 3"5 slots, it's perfect for a small home nas in micro ATX if you add 3 140mm dust filters

        A practical case leaves something to be desired

        It's a beautiful, dark and utilitarian case. The sliding bays for the hard drives are very handy. The removable filter in the bottom is a welcome addition and the two USB3 ports on the front panel are nice to have, considering the price.

        However, the front panel cables are a bit short. I couldn't route them through the back, I had to plug them in through the front of the GPU, which works but isn't so pretty. I will probably buy extension cables in the future to have better airflow and cable management.

        Overall, I'm happy with the case. It seems spacious and offers a good number of options in terms of drive and fan placement.

        good box

        I am very pleased with the quality of the product and the price.
        This box is not a top of the range but is in conformity with its price
        Attention the USB plugs in front are exclusively USB3.
        The LEDs on the front are far too powerful.
        The 2 fans of the case are quite quiet.
        However, the case does not filter any noise because there are air vents everywhere.
        The hard disks are fixed on rubber shock absorbers so no vibrations

        Very good value for money

        I chose this box because it was available and without windows :-) More seriously I based my choice on the LDLC reviews and I am not disappointed. So it's not a high end box but it does its job perfectly. What really surprised me is that it is relatively quiet. When used for a video editing setup, all the components are at ease: GTX 1660, two SSDs, 2 HDDs and a burner and there's still plenty of room! The assembly went without a hitch, the screws are abundant! I recommend this product!

        good finish and modularity

        I already own a Define R4 from Fractal Design, so I was tempted by the Core 2500 for a more modest budget. The finish is good and the accessories provided are sufficient (numerous screws for HDD, CM, fans, anti-vibration pads...). It is especially less wide than the Define (which I can't install in my computer cabinet because of its excessive width!)
        In conclusion a well finished case delivered with two 120mm fans (140 would have been better).
